Exchange Coverage and Technical Depth

BeLiquid operates across 70+ centralised and decentralised exchanges, including Binance, MEXC, Bybit, OKX, KuCoin, Gate.io, Kraken, Coinbase, Uniswap, PancakeSwap, and more. Exchange relationships of this breadth take years to build and are not easily replicated.

On the technical side, BeLiquid’s proprietary market-making engine includes adaptive spread control and smart throttling mechanisms that protect order book depth during aggressive sell pressure, something most boutique agencies lack entirely. The firm’s published guide on how market-making bots work gives a clear sense of the engineering depth behind their approach.

Their anti-delisting operations are also worth noting. MEXC, Bybit, and Binance all monitor listed tokens against specific compliance thresholds, including spread, depth, and trading frequency. Projects that fall below these thresholds face warning periods and possible removal. BeLiquid monitors these metrics proactively and maintains documented response protocols. We reviewed their MEXC market-making guide and Binance listing guide. Both are precise, current, and reflect genuine operational knowledge of how these exchanges work.

Pricing and Accessibility

Unlike institutional desks that effectively require $100M+ market cap projects to engage, BeLiquid structures engagements for projects from the listing stage through the growth phase. Their market-making cost guide is the most transparent pricing resource we found from any market maker, covering retainer ranges, working capital requirements, and the token loan model with an honest analysis of the trade-offs.

Early-stage, single-exchange engagements start at $3,000 to $8,000 per month in retainer fees, with working capital requirements remaining separate and tailored to each project.
